An analysis/synthesis cooperation for head tracking and video face cloning

Valente, Stéphane; Dugelay, Jean-Luc; Delingette, Hervé
ECCV workshop on perception of human action, June 1998, Freiburg, Germany

In the context of a face cloning system, we present a head tracking algorithm based on an enhanced analysis/synthesis feedback loop which is able to handle very large rotations out of the image plane. The key idea is to make the feedback loop synthesize search patterns for the head facial features by taking into account the current face position, rotation and lighting. As pointed out by the work of A. Gagalowicz, analysis/synthesis cooperations are very promissing, but require a high level of realism from the synthesis module. Consequently, we present geometric and photometric head modeling techniques that are realistic and computationally efficient. Finally, we reformulate a classic differential block{matching algorithm to integrate real and synthesized facial features. In addition, the feature tracking will be shown to be robust to the speaker's background, and the system performance are reported and discussed.
